#71bf44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71bf44 is composed of 44.3% red, 74.9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 98 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 50.8%. #71bf44 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ff88 with #007f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#71bf44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71bf44 has RGB values of R:113, G:191,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 7454532.

Shades and Tints of #71bf44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#71bf44
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81857e is the less saturated color, while #61f90a is the most saturated one.
